Luc Delahaye Gallery, Inspired by a documentary approach to photography, Delahaye's large-scale color prints encourage reflection about the relationships among art, information, and history. His pictures are characterized by detachment, directness and rich details, a documentary approach which is however countered by dramatic intensity and a narrative structure. As a Magnum and Newsweek photographer, Luc Delahaye covered many of the most recent areas of conflict like, for example, Bosnia, Chechnya, Afghanistan. Through his mostly large-scale color works – documenting conflicts in Haiti, Iraq, Libya and Ukraine, as well as OPEC and COP conferences – he examines the turbulent world we A photograph like Luc Delahaye’s shot of a dead Taliban soldier – which could justifiably appear in a traditional news update– raises a number of questions around how the meaning of an image shifts with its presentational context. Unlike the ceaseless, sensationalist flow of mass media images, Delahaye's photographs of war, natural catastrophes, or political upheaval, evade straightforward interpretation or resolution. Luc Delahaye (born 1962) is a French photographer known for his largescale color works depicting conflicts, world events or social issues.
